The Monks are a rock and roll band, primarily active in Germany in the mid to late sixties. They reunited in 1999 and
have continued to play concerts, although no new studio recordings have been made. The Monks stood out from the music of
the time, and have developed a cult following amongst many musicians and music fans. Artists to have acknowledged the
Monks as an influence include Henry Rollins, the Beastie Boys and Jello Biafra of the Dead Kennedys, as well as The
Fall. The latter covered both 'I Hate You' and 'Oh, How To Do Now' on their 1990 album Extricate (under the titles
'Black Monk Theme Part I' and 'Black Monk Theme Part II', respectively), as well as the song 'Shut Up!' on their 1994
album Middle Class Revolt. The Fall have also covered 'Higgledy-Piggledy' for a forthcoming Monks tribute CD.
